摘要

The continuous progress of VLSI technology has provided the possibility of integrating large sensor arrays and signal processors on a single chip. The speed requirements on the data conversion circuits are not necessarily very high but the reduction of size and power consumption is more important. Inherent advantages such as design simplicity and lower power consumption of current-mode techniques are exploited in the Analog to Digital (A/D) converter presented in this paper. A converter array with a common reference-generator that can achieve a high conversion rate at relatively low hardware cost is developed. The A/D converter array integrated with a current-mode data-acquisition system and sensor array can provide a high quality smart sensor.
